Grady is about 3 1/2 months old now. He was saved from a kill pound down south when our rescue partner was told there was a pup in the pound with an injured leg and unless someone got him the next day he would be euthanized. Of course she went early the next morning and got him. When she got him he was unable to stand at all on his rear legs but while holding him she found a tick behind his ear. She removed the tick, put the puppy in his kennel for the night and the next morning he came walking out all on his own! It's rare but Grady had tick paralysis. All that was needed to make him well was to remove the tick. Grady is great with other dogs both large and small and a real lover of people. He loves to play with toys and loves to be with people.
